Statement of Interest

Olga Cavalli - Nominating Committee Appointee

I hold a degree in Electronic and Electric Engineer, an MBA, a Masters Degree in Telecommunication Regulation and a PhD in Business Administration.

>From the academic side, I am a professor at the University of Buenos Aires, at the Instituto Tecnológico Buenos Aires and at the Diplomacy Career of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Argentina. In these institutions I teach technology, organizational structure and public policy related with technology.

I am a member of the MAG, Multistakeholder Advisory Group for the Internet Governance Forum (IGF).

In the private sector, I have worked as a consultant for companies and non-governmental organizations in Argentina, Brazil, Chile, Uruguay, Venezuela, USA, Canada and Germany.

Presently these are the most important projects I am involved in:

Enhance Internet connectivity in rural areas in the interior of Argentina - Jointly with UNESCO.

South School on Internet Governance - Third edition - Mexico DF April 2011.

Telecommunications and Internet license management for rural Internet connectivity projects including e-commerce platforms for agricultural cooperatives.

President of the Forum "Women, engineering and business" of the World Engineering Congress 2010 and president of the Commission "Women engineers for development in Argentina" in the Centro Argentino de Ingenieros.

In the near future I plan also to be involved in the following activities:

Roaming regulations harmonization in Latin America - Project financed by the Interamerican Bank of Development BID.

Fellowship program for "Women engineers for development in Argentina".

Commercial and marketing strategic planning for domain name resellers in Latin America and the Caribbean.

Public wifi network development for cities in Argentina.

I am also the Secretary of the ISOC Argentina chapter ISOC AR and a certified engineer of the National Engineers Council.
